Topic: Editing posts removes the sig.
Posted By: sinus
Subject: Editing posts removes the sig.
Date Posted: 23 April 2008 at 9:39pm
As an admin, if I edit someone's post, their signature disappears from the post.
Any guesses as to why that is?

Posted By: WebWiz-Bruce
Date Posted: 24 April 2008 at 2:09pm
It will still show the signature of the person who posted, however, when you edit the post there is a 'show signature' option this option lets you decide if the posters signature is shown or not at the bottom of the post.
